Handover — spare hardware store, Unit 4, Tarnbrook Depot

Quick note before I'm off site. The spare-hardware room is the grey door past the goods lift, marked "Stores — Keller Systems." Contractors can take replacement PSUs, cabling, and patch panels from the left-hand racking only; everything on the right is reserved for the Oakfield rollout. Record what you take in the ledger on the shelf by the door and relock when leaving. The door keypad opens with the code below.

door code, yagap-bahof: bdg-O-05

**Vendor note: Inkmill markdown pipeline**

Rendering for Parchway docs is outsourced to Inkmill under an annual contract, renewing each March. They handle sanitization and PDF export; we own the upload queue. SLA: 4-hour response on rendering failures. Escalate only after two failed retries. Their support desk is reachable at the address below.

billing contact of hahaf-baguf = zorael.tammir.jorius@sivrelhq.internal

**Action item 4: Dedupe customer records (owner: on-call rotation)**

The Lanternfall incident happened because the Custkeep table had three rows for the same customer and the billing job picked the stale one. Short term: run the `dupescan` report weekly and merge anything it flags before Friday billing. Longer term, the Mergewright service will enforce uniqueness at write time, but that's a quarter out. Merge steps and gotchas are written up on the internal page here.

operations page: https://jira.qorvelsys.internal/browse/pages/browse/pages

The Quillport export endpoint normalizes all timestamps to UTC before rendering, then applies the caller's `tz` parameter at the formatting layer only. If `tz` is omitted, exports fall back to the workspace default, which can silently differ from the scheduler's zone — flag this in review. Testing against the staging exporter requires authenticating with the key below.

gateway credential: kto3_qfe

# charsniff env configuration
# Welcome aboard. This service guesses the encoding of uploaded
# text files for the Tollgrave archive project. Detection order
# is controlled by SNIFF_CHAIN; do not reorder it without a
# corpus rerun. Results are written to the metadata store, and
# the store credential is declared on the line that follows.

vault entry, yahaf-tagug: LEDGER_TOKEN20=884d77d1a8b98aa4edfb